Maryland Stem Cell Research Commission Awards More Than $12.6 Million to Advance Regenerative Medicine Research
The Maryland Stem Cell Research Commission (“Commission”) announced 38 new awards totaling $12,665,189 through the Maryland Stem Cell Research Fund (“MSCRF” or the “Fund”) to support cutting-edge stem cell and regenerative medicine research, technology development and commercialization across Maryland. MSCRF is an independent program within TEDCO.
